COMMIT

Name

COMMIT  --  Realiza la transacción actual

Synopsis

COMMIT [ WORK | TRANSACTION ]
  

Inputs

WORK, TRANSACTION

Palabra clave opcional. No tiene efecto.

Outputs

COMMIT

Mensaje devuelto si la transacción se realiza con exito.

NOTICE: COMMIT: no transaction in progress

Si no hay transacciones en progreso.

Description

COMMIT realiza la transacción actual. Todos los cambios realizados por la transacción son visibles a las otras transacciones, y se garantiza que se conservan si se produce una caida de la máquina.

Notes

Las palabras clave WORK y TRANSACTION son demasiado informativas, y pueden ser omitidas.

Use ROLLBACK para abortar una transacción.

Usage

Para hacer todos los cambios permanentes:

COMMIT WORK;
   

Compatibilidad

SQL92

SQL92 solo especifica las dos formas, COMMIT y COMMIT WORK. Por lo demás, es totalmente compatible.